Optician

As an Optician, customer service is priority one! You'll assist patients with selecting and ordering eyewear, adjustments and fittings, and educating on proper eyeglass and contact lens care. Your initiative and organizational skills will keep us running at top performance, while your enthusiasm and knowledge will provide an exceptional patient experience.

Responsibilities

  • Interprets prescription and helps patients choose appropriate eyewear, consulting with prescribing physicians as appropriate
  • Takes optical measurements necessary for eyewear preparation
  • Orders eyewear from laboratory based on prescription and patient preference
  • Performs quality inspection of lenses and frames
  • Adjusts eyewear to patient using appropriate tools and instruct on cleaning and handling
  • Makes any necessary repairs using appropriate parts and tools
  • Maintains equipment and inventory of supplies

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ED required; Bachelor's degree preferred
  • Previous optical experience preferred; willing to train if eager to learn
  • ABO and NCLE is a plus, will be required within 6 months of hire
  • Licensed Dispensing Optician (LDO) is a plus
  • Detailed oriented, reliable and able to multi-task in a fast-paced, high-volume work environment
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Strong computer skills, including Word and Excel
  • Flexible schedule working Monday through Friday
